BASS, TREBLE

T

he DPTV also has individual
sound adjustment controls for

the ATSC system audio. The BASS
(low frequency) and TREBLE
(high frequency) controls may be
used to adjust the sound of ATSC
TV programs, or other external
playback source material.

Select Bass or Treble sound

control.

With the Sound Menu on-screen,
move the highlight with the
MENU ▲▼ buttons. Then press
the MENU (or ok) button.

Press the MENU

ᮤ ᮣ

arrow

buttons to adjust the sound control
to levels you prefer.

Press the “exit” button to clear

the screen.

Treble and Bass are set to factory midpoint or default
levels when the barscale adjustments are placed to the
center detent position.

AUTO VOLUME

P

erforming a function similar to
the AVL sound control (in the

NTSC operating mode) the Auto
Volume control applies certain
value levels to variables within the
Dolby sound standard in order to
achieve dynamic audio range
compression. This single value
setting by the Auto Volume control
allows for a more consistent, even
sound reproduction in the
playback of ATSC audio.

Select Auto Volume sound

control.

With the Sound Menu on-screen,
move the highlight with the
MENU ▲▼ buttons. Then press
the MENU (or ok) button.

Press the MENU

ᮤ ᮣ

arrow

buttons to set the Auto Volume
control to Day Time Listening (for
non-compressed full range audio
signals); or Night Time Listening
to receive a compressed ATSC
audio signal.

Press the “exit” button to clear

the screen.
